What is Freight Logistics?
Headquartered in Wichita, Kansas, Freight Logistics operates as a specialized, family-run carrier focused on the critical segment of temperature-controlled freight. The company maintains a sophisticated fleet of modern Peterbilt trucks, specifically engineered to transport sensitive goods such as meat, fruit, and produce. Beyond its technical capabilities, the organization distinguishes itself through a human-centric operational model, emphasizing driver retention and high-quality benefits packages. This dual focus on equipment reliability and workforce stability has allowed the company to cultivate a reputation for excellence in the highly demanding cold chain logistics market.
